Welcome and I very much doubt a 23i exhaust will fit the 18i because they're entirely different engines (6 pot vs 4 pot). You'll have to look for a specific N20 (18i/20i/28i) exhaust.

also allows on touch opening and closing, auto fold mirrors if you have them, you can set how you want the windows to act when opening the roof, it can change the unlocking of the doors plus you can also set it to continue opening/closing even after taking the key out although I would advise against that option for safety reasons
